    ### Technical Overview: 2SC5359-R Transistor The **2SC5359-R** is a high-power NPN Silicon Triple Diffused Planar Transistor. It is primarily designed for high-fidelity (Hi-Fi) audio power amplification and general-purpose power switching applications. --- ### 1. Key Features & Specifications The "R" suffix typically refers to the **hFE (DC Current Gain) classification**, indicating a specific range of gain performance. | Parameter | Symbol | Rating | Unit | | :--- | :--- | :--- | :--- | | Collector-Base Voltage | $V_{CBO}$ | 180 | V | | Collector-Emitter Voltage | $V_{CEO}$ | 180 | V | | Emitter-Base Voltage | $V_{EBO}$ | 5 | V | | Collector Current (DC) | $I_C$ | 15 | A | | Base Current | $I_B$ | 1.5 | A | | Collector Power Dissipation | $P_C$ | 150 | W | | Junction Temperature | $T_j$ | 150 | °C | ### 2. Physical Characteristics * **Package Type:** TO-3P(L) or TO-264 (depending on manufacturer). * **Mounting:** Through-hole mounting. * **Complementary Pair:** Usually paired with the **2SA1987** (PNP) for push-pull amplifier stages. ### 3. Gain Classification (hFE) The "R" classification defines the DC current gain range under specific test conditions (usually $V_{CE} = 5V, I_C = 1A$): * **R Rank:** 55 to 110 * **O Rank:** 80 to 160 --- ### 4. Typical Applications The 2SC5359-R is favored in high-end electronics due to its linearity and power handling: 1. **Audio Power Amplifiers:** Used in the output stage of 100W+ per channel home theater receivers and professional audio gear. 2. **DC-DC Converters:** High-current switching applications. 3. **Voltage Regulators:** High-power linear regulators. --- ### 5. Schematic Symbol & Pinout ```text (Base) 1 [---] | | (Collector) 2 [---] (Metal Tab) | | (Emitter) 3 [---] ``` * **Pin 1:** Base (B) * **Pin 2:** Collector (C) - Connected to the mounting tab. * **Pin 3:** Emitter (E) --- ### 6. Design Considerations * **Heat Dissipation:** Because it can dissipate up to 150W, a substantial heatsink and thermal paste are mandatory to prevent thermal runaway. * **Protection:** It is recommended to use emitter resistors ($0.22\Omega$ to $0.47\Omega$) in parallel configurations to ensure current balancing.
